Jerome Meraz appeals the district court’s1 adverse grant of summary judgment in his pro se 42 U.S.C. § 1983 action. After careful review of the record and the parties’ arguments on appeal, we conclude that the district court properly granted summary judgment. See Morris v. Cradduck, 954 F.3d 1055, 1058 (8th Cir. 2020) (grant of summary judgment is reviewed de novo). Accordingly, we affirm, and we deny Meraz’s pending motions as moot. See 8th Cir. R. 47B. ______________________________
